The choice depends on performance needs, heat dissipation, and budget:
Desktop CPU Advantages (Performance): Strong power with high multi-core capabilities. They use higher process technology, more cores, and higher clock speeds (e.g., i7/Ryzen 7 Desktop series). They can easily handle High-Load Scenarios like 3D modeling, video rendering, and large-scale gaming. Rendering speed can be 30%-50% faster than mobile CPUs.
Laptop CPU Advantages (Efficiency): Low power consumption and low heat. Designed for thin devices, they balance performance and battery life (TDP 15W-35W). They generate less heat, requiring less from the cooling system, resulting in Quieter Fan Noise and longer hardware life. Perfect for daily office work, web browsing, and video meetings.
Heat Dissipation: Desktop CPUs require robust cooling (dual fans + heat pipes) to avoid throttling. Laptop CPUs run cooler but have a lower performance ceiling. If the AIO chassis is ultra-thin, a Laptop CPU is a safer choice for stability.
Cost & Upgradability: Desktop CPUs are more expensive and require higher-spec components but may offer upgradability (if the socket allows). Laptop CPUs are often soldered (non-upgradable) but allow for a more cost-controlled, energy-efficient system.
Summary: For Professional Creation/Gaming, choose a Desktop CPU. For Energy Saving/Light Office/Budget, choose a Laptop CPU. Check the model suffix (e.g., i7-13700H is Laptop, i7-13700K is Desktop).
